Quartet First in UA's History to Win International Horn Competition
The Capstone Horn Quartet, also known as Tater and the Tots, has become the first University of Alabama horn quartet to win the International Horn Society Summer Symposium Student Amateur Quartet Competition, which was held earlier at Ball State University in Muncie, Indiana. The members of the quartet are Matthew "Tater" Meadows, a 23-year-old senior music education major, of Jasper; Antonio Padilla, 21-year-old senior music education major, of Meridian, Mississippi; Anthony Parrish, 22-year-old senior music education major, of Kimberly; and Charlie Snead, a 21-year-old senior music performance major, of Northport. "We have some great folks doing some great things," said Charles "Skip" Snead, director and horn professor in UA's School of Music. "This is the first time we've had a quartet win the international competition. "I'm incredibly proud of them. They put in a lot of hard work, many hours of preparation. They all play individually very well, but when they get together it's a really great combination." Skip Snead, whose son is Charlie Snead, said Tater and the Tots competed against some of the best student horn players from throughout the U.S. and the world. In the final competition, they competed against five quartets in a concert for a live audience and a panel of five judges. Declared the winners, Tater and the Tots were selected to give an additional performance on the final day of the workshop in a special concert where all the competition winners performed. Meadows, who picked up the nickname Tater in high school, said competing in the competition, let alone winning it, was a leap of faith for them. "We put a lot of preparation into it," he said. "We made the goal to go and compete in a rash decision we made in March after we won the Southeast Horn Workshop back in February at the University of Georgia in Athens. "We just worked diligently, perfecting some tough pieces we selected, the stuff the professionals would play, and we won." The quartet has been playing together for about 10 months. They received a certificate for their win.

UA Dance Students to Perform in Edinburgh Fringe Festival With Yonder Ensemble
The Yonder Contemporary Dance Company, a collective in The University of Alabama's department of theatre and dance, will present a 50-minute concert titled "IRL" during the 2018 Edinburgh Festival Fringe in Scotland. The performances will run Aug. 4-10. Yonder's "IRL" involves 15 dance majors, overseen by Sarah M. Barry, associate professor of dance. They are collaborating with five student composers from UA's School of Music, who are overseen by Dr. Amir Zaheri, assistant professor of composition. The collaboration also includes a media specialist from UA's department of advertising and public relations, overseen by Mark Barry, director of creative advertising specialization. The dance majors will perform "IRL" at the Greenside @ Nicolson Square venue in Edinburgh. "'IRL' focuses on the pervasive nature of technology and illuminates the jarring battle between everyone and everything that competes for our attention," said Sarah Barry, who is the artistic director of the company. "We have tried to address this material from different angles because there are a variety of perspectives to consider. Some are big and obvious while others are more nuanced. We have worked hard to keep the discussion open and the research ongoing. The show will continue to evolve as we share our work and take in audience feedback." To prepare for the performances, Yonder participants hosted master classes and performances during a regional tour in spring 2018. Sites included the Dance Foundation in Birmingham; Florence Academy of Fine Arts in Florence; the Buckman Theatre in Memphis, Tennessee; and the Marcus Jewish Community Center in Atlanta. "The tour allowed students to make and refine their creative work and performance over a longer time to different audiences, giving them a window into the professional company life of touring, teaching, performing, writing grants, fundraising and promoting dance," Barry said. Samford University Commencement Spring 2018
A record 1,240 degrees were awarded. That tops the 2017 record of 1,165. An estimated 250 students graduated with honors. In the seven commencement ceremonies, 33 different degree programs were recognized, including the first graduates in the Doctor of Physical Therapy, Master of Athletic Training, Master of Science in Respiratory Care, Master of Science in Health Informatics and Bachelor of Science in healthcare administration programs in the College of Health Sciences. Graduating students represented 28 states and seven other countries: United Kingdom, Malaysia, China, France, South Korea, Canada and Germany.
